PHP Ionic Angular HTML5 AJAX Javascript CSS MySQL jQuery Forum


รบกวนช่วยหน่อยครับ ปฏิทินไม่ได้ซักทีครับ ติดตรง data_events.php

ถาม-ตอบ แนะนำไอเดียว โค้ดตัวอย่าง แนวทาง วิธีแก้ปัญหา รบกวนช่วยหน่อยครับ ปฏิทินไม่ได้ซักทีครับ ติดตรง data_events.php

รบกวนช่วยหน่อยครับ ปฏิทินไม่ได้ซักทีครับ ติดตรง data_events.php
<?php
header("Content-type:application/json; charset=UTF-8");          
header("Cache-Control: no-store, no-cache, must-revalidate");         
header("Cache-Control: post-check=0, pre-check=0", false);    
require("conn.php");
if(isset($_GET['gData']) && $_GET['gData']|=""){
    $q="SELECT * FROM tbl_event WHERE date(event_start)>='".$_GET['start']."'  ";  
    $q.=" AND date(event_end)<='".$_GET['end']."' ORDER by event_id";  
    $result = $mysqli->query($q);
    while($rs=$result->fetch_object()){
        $json_data[]=array(  
            "id"=>$rs->event_id,
            "title"=>$rs->event_title,
            "start"=>$rs->event_start,
            "end"=>$rs->event_end,
            "url"=>$rs->event_url,
            "allDay"=>($rs->event_allDay==true)?true:false      
            // กำหนด event object property อื่นๆ ที่ต้องการ
        );    
    }  
}
$json_data=(isset($json_data))?$json_data:NULL;
$json= json_encode($json_data);  
if(isset($_GET['callback']) && $_GET['callback']!=""){  
echo $_GET['callback']."(".$json.");";      
}else{  
echo $json;  
} 
?>


โดย:  Anakin Kin IP: 171.7.89.xxx วันที่: 18-09-2018 เวลา: 19:28:12

คำแนะนำ และการใช้งาน

สมาชิก กรุณา ล็อกอินเข้าระบบ เพื่อตั้งคำถามใหม่ หรือ ตอบคำถาม สมาชิกใหม่ สมัครสมาชิกได้ที่ สมัครสมาชิก


  • ถาม-ตอบ กรุณา ล็อกอินเข้าระบบ


  • ( หรือ สามารถทำการ สมัครสมาชิก และล็อกอิน ด้วย ปุ่ม Log in with Facebook ด้านล่าง )
 ความคิดเห็นที่ 1

error แบบนี้ครับ

<br />
<b>Notice</b>:  Undefined index: start in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>7</b><br />
<br />
<b>Notice</b>:  Undefined index: end in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>8</b><br />
<br />
<b>Notice</b>:  Undefined variable: mysqli in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>9</b><br />
<br />
<b>Fatal error</b>:  Call to a member function query() on a non-object in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>9</b><br />


โดย:  Anakin Kin IP: 171.7.89.xxx วันที่: 18-09-2018 เวลา: 19:29:06
 ความคิดเห็นที่ 2

ใส่ http://localhost:8080/test/data_events.php?gData=1&start=2010-08-02&end=2010-08-31

ก็ขึ้นแบบนี้ครับ

<br />
<b>Notice</b>:  Undefined variable: mysqli in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>9</b><br />
<br />
<b>Fatal error</b>:  Call to a member function query() on a non-object in <b>K:USBWebserver v8.58.5roottestdata_events.php</b> on line <b>9</b><br />


โดย:  Anakin Kin IP: 171.7.89.xxx วันที่: 18-09-2018 เวลา: 19:46:18
 ความคิดเห็นที่ 3
ตรวจสอบว่า ที่เครื่องรองรับการใช้งาน mysqli หรือเปล่า หรือเปิดใช้งาน mysqli แล้วไหม
และก็ตรวจสอบการกำหนดการเชื่อมต่อกับฐานข้อมูล ตามแนวทาง ด้านล่างดู

https://www.ninenik.com/forum_view_2398_1.html#comment_5642

หรือใช้รูปแบบการเชื่อมต่อฐานข้อมูลในไฟล์ conn.php ลักษณะแบบนี้ดู

<?php  
$mysqli = new mysqli("localhost", "ชื่อ user","รหัสผ่าน","ชื่อ database");  
/* check connection */
if ($mysqli->connect_errno) {  
    printf("Connect failed: %s\n", $mysqli->connect_error);  
    exit();  
}  
if(!$mysqli->set_charset("utf8")) {  
    printf("Error loading character set utf8: %sn", $mysqli->error);  
    exit();  
}


โดย:  Ninenik IP: 183.88.76.xxx วันที่: 19-09-2018